On Wed, 2009-03-04 at 10:48 +1100, Avi Miller wrote: > Hi David, > > David Lutterkort wrote: > > You definitely should read up on path expressions[1] for that, and maybe > > even have a look at the test cases for them[2], since they show some > > more esoteric uses. > > I'm still having a bit of a brain disconnect on converting Augeas' XPath > stuff into Puppet types. > > Here is my test Puppet entry: > > augeas { "pam_set_cracklib": > context => "/files/etc/pam.d/system-auth", > changes => "rm *[module='pam_cracklib.so']/argument", > onlyif => "match *[module='pam_cracklib.so'][count(argument)>5]", > } > > Which, theoretically, should remove all the arguments if the entry that > contains the pam_cracklib.so module has more than 5 arguments. > > If I run the match (in the onlyif line) in augtool, I get: > > augtool> match > /files/etc/pam.d/system-auth/*[module='pam_cracklib.so'][count(argument)>5] > /files/etc/pam.d/system-auth/8 = (none) > > Which suggests that line 8 in that file matches. > > However, when I run this entry in Puppet, I get: > > err: //Node[testnode]/pam/Augeas[pam_set_cracklib]: Failed to retrieve > current state of resource: Error sending command 'match' with params > ["/files/etc/pam.d/system-auth/*[module='pam_cracklib.so'][count(argument)>5]"]/Invalid > > command: match > /files/etc/pam.d/system-auth/*[module='pam_cracklib.so'][count(argument)>5] > > Any ideas? > > Essentially, what I'm trying to achieve is the capability to change > pam.d file entries if they don't match what they're supposed to.
If you have Augeas 0.4.1 on both the puppet client and master (count was only added in 0.4.1) this should work. Bryan, any ideas what could be wrong ?
